  • U.S. Ambassador to EU Sondland says Trump intends to recall him from his post

    02/07/2020 4:16:53 PM PST · by mdittmar · 57 replies
    Reuters ^ | February 7, 2020 | Karen Freifeld
    (Reuters) - U.S. Ambassador to the European Union Gordon Sondland, who testified in President Donald Trump’s impeachment inquiry, said on Friday that Trump intends to recall him from his post. “I was advised today that the President intends to recall me effective immediately as United States Ambassador to the European Union,” Sondland said in a statement.

    Two days after losing a bid for a second term, Sen. Lincoln Chafee said he was unsure whether he would remain a Republican. Two days after failing to secure another term, Rhode Island Sen. Lincoln Chafee considers leaving the Republican Party. Chafee lost to Democrat Sheldon Whitehouse in a race seen as a referendum on President Bush and the GOP. On Thursday, he was asked whether he would stick with the Republican Party or become an independent or Democrat. "I haven't made any decisions. I just haven't even thought about where my place is," Chafee said at a news conference....
